Overwatch Trademark Suspended Due to Previously Filed Application

Blizzard Entertainment's name could be changed when it releases.

Blizzard Entertainment dazzled us with its online multiplayer first person shooter Overwatch when it was first announced at Blizzon 2014. As the PvP portion of the abandoned Project Titan MMO, it impressed audiences with its visual style and intriguing gameplay. Though the beta is scheduled for later this year, Overwatch may not be named as such when it finally releases.

NeoGAF recently dug up the suspension of Overwatch’s two trademark applications by the USPTO. This is due to a previous trademark filed by Innovis Labs, Inc. for the name Overwatch. Unless Innovis abandons its trademark application or allows Blizzard to use the name, its applications will remain suspended.

This isn’t to say that Blizzard couldn’t pursue the matter so we’ll have to wait and see what the developer does on this front. Will Overwatch’s name be changed before the game is finally out? We’ll find out in the coming months so stay tuned for more information.
